Zhoie will be 4 yrs in Jan and if I go out...she goes to her house (crate). She is very laid back and wouldn't bother a thing. All I have to do is say, "mommy has to go out and you can't go this time" and she goes to her house. For her, it's her safe place, she goes there sometimes while I'm working in my office (I work from home) and sleeps with the door open.
For me, she will never be left out if we aren't home, not because she would get into anything, but for my peace of mind. I feel like if there is a fire, they will get to her in her crate with the sticker that flags them on the sunroom where her crate is. I know many dogs run and hide in the event of a fire and would not be found. But, maybe that is just me being over cautious.
